$10 per night is how much hostels in Wuhan cost, on average. $4 per night was the lowest price recently found by HotelsCombined users - but anything for $9 per night or less is a good deal. Wuhan hostel prices fluctuate throughout the year, with July being the most expensive month to book, and in November being the cheapest.
